Franchise Agreement Overview — Managers Only

This page details the updated franchise agreement governing all Pellforth Coffee House locations. Key changes include a revised royalty tier, mandatory sourcing through Arbenlow Roasters, and a stricter brand-compliance audit cycle of six months. Branch managers should review the obligations section thoroughly, as non-compliance penalties have increased. Questions should be routed through your regional lead. The agreement's timing is linked to the following.

board note of hafog-kafop: Only 50 of the 505 pilot accounts renewed Eliys, so a churn review is set for April 7. Fravanox Partners is in early talks to buy Tamvanix Logistics for about $273.9 million.

Handing off the Quillbus broker upgrade (4.x to 5.1) to Dario. Cluster is half-migrated; mixed-version mode is supported but TLS cert rotation must finish before cutover. No auth model changes, though the admin API gained two new endpoints worth reviewing. Open questions and the migration checklist are tracked on the internal page below.

dashboard of taduf-bawef = https://jira.lumicsys.internal/projects/display/browse/b1cbf89d

Ticket QDS-412: The queue-depth autoscaler build from the Lintfarm pipeline failed its signature verification during rollout to the Perrow cluster. The verifier reports a digest mismatch on scaler-agent v2.8.1, so the deploy halted at the canary stage. We confirmed the artifact itself is intact; the issue is that the verifier is still pinned to the retired signing identity. Please update the trust store before retrying. The correct key is included below.

release key, fajef-kajeg: bky19_LdLu6Ne6FLi8he2c24d

Team,

As we finalize next year's headcount plan for Quenholm Systems, I want the sales leads aligned early. We are budgeting for twelve additional quota-carrying roles, weighted toward the Arlet Valley territory, plus two sales-engineering hires supporting the Mirago platform. Backfills will require VP approval, and we expect offers to begin in the second fiscal month. Ramp assumptions are conservative at five months to full productivity. Please review the confidential planning note appended below before our Thursday session.

confidential, hahop-bajep: Gross margin on Ralath came in at 5 percent against a plan of 10 percent. Only 9 of the 100 pilot accounts renewed Ralath, so a churn review is set for April 1.